The Chile Table Top Sweeteners Market is experiencing steady growth driven by increasing health consciousness among consumers seeking to reduce sugar intake. The market is predominantly dominated by popular sweeteners such as stevia, sucralose, and aspartame, with a rising demand for natural sweeteners due to their perceived health benefits. The trend towards healthier lifestyles and the prevalence of diabetes and obesity are key factors propelling the market`s expansion. Local and international players are actively introducing innovative products and flavors to cater to diverse consumer preferences. The market is characterized by intense competition, leading to aggressive marketing strategies and product differentiation. Overall, the Chile Table Top Sweeteners Market presents promising opportunities for growth and innovation in the foreseeable future.

In Chile, the government sets regulations and standards for table top sweeteners to ensure consumer safety and fair competition in the market. The Ministry of Health oversees the approval and monitoring of sweeteners to ensure they meet safety standards for consumption. Additionally, the National Consumer Service (SERNAC) protects consumer rights by monitoring pricing practices and ensuring accurate labeling of sweeteners. Import regulations also play a role in governing the Chilean table top sweeteners market, with the National Customs Service (SNA) enforcing import duties and regulations to control the influx of foreign sweeteners. Overall, government policies in Chile aim to promote a competitive and safe market environment for table top sweeteners, safeguarding consumer interests and ensuring compliance with quality standards.
